Output f160052ed6665590e9a14837333992a96a143f7ba6feef45b73cb49f0ba067dc:1

value
95698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f28895695a81e9b7f0db711c068ec27fddea2264 OP_EQUAL
address
3PoR4xtCMLadGSzUaZ7na7438jpHXz18tA
transaction
f160052ed6665590e9a14837333992a96a143f7ba6feef45b73cb49f0ba067dc
confirmations
399781
spent
true